Ancora Advisors LLC - ALGOMA STL GROUP INC ownership

ALGOMA STL GROUP INC's ticker is and the CUSIP is 015658107. A total of 110 filers reported holding ALGOMA STL GROUP INC in Q3 2023. The put-call ratio across all filers is 0.06 and the average weighting 0.8%.

Quarter-by-quarter ownership
Ancora Advisors LLC ownership history of ALGOMA STL GROUP INC
ValueSharesWeighting
Q3 2023$180,200
-4.2%
26,5000.0%0.01%0.0%
Q2 2023$188,150
-12.1%
26,5000.0%0.01%
-16.7%
Q1 2023$214,120
+15879.1%
26,500
-87.5%
0.01%
-84.6%
Q4 2022$1,340
-99.8%
211,334
+82.7%
0.04%
+69.6%
Q3 2022$745,000
-28.3%
115,6670.0%0.02%
-20.7%
Q2 2022$1,039,000
-20.7%
115,667
-0.6%
0.03%
-9.4%
Q1 2022$1,310,000
+4.5%
116,367
+0.4%
0.03%
+6.7%
Q4 2021$1,253,000115,8670.03%
Other shareholders
ALGOMA STL GROUP INC shareholders Q3 2023
NameSharesValueWeighting ↓
INVESCO SENIOR SECURED MANAGEMENT INC /ADV 2,806,214$22,674,20932.94%
CONTRARIAN CAPITAL MANAGEMENT, L.L.C. 5,830,405$47,109,67212.17%
LITTLEJOHN & CO LLC 2,373,157$19,175,10911.47%
AEGIS FINANCIAL CORP 1,217,098$9,834,1527.63%
Sonic GP LLC 1,200,000$9,696,0007.41%
Solas Capital Management, LLC 1,327,751$10,728,2285.73%
THOMIST CAPITAL MANAGEMENT, LP 1,223,323$9,333,9545.51%
Bain Capital Credit, LP 2,888,719$23,340,8515.04%
Maple Rock Capital Partners 6,491,299$52,449,6964.63%
TOWLE & CO 2,626,990$21,226,0792.99%
View complete list of ALGOMA STL GROUP INC shareholders